Tex. Educ. Code § 21.035

DELEGATION AUTHORITY; ADMINISTRATION BY AGENCY

Added by Acts 1995, 74th Leg., ch. 260, Sec. 1, eff

(a) The board is permitted to make a written delegation of authority to the commissioner or the agency to informally dispose of a contested case involving educator certification.

(b) The agency shall provide the board's administrative functions and services.
